Leroy Valencia of Raton, New Mexico went home to heaven on March 30 2026.
He was born on August 10, 1944 in Otis , New Mexico to parents Gene and Lucy Valencia.
He was preceded in death by his brother Geno Valencia and is survived by his wife of 37 years, Janet Valencia. He is also survived by his 3 sons Alex, Jason, and Zach , and daughter Valerie and 8 grandkids and 5 great grand kids with one more to be born this year.
Mr. Valencia was a decorated combat veteran in the Army 9th infantry division and received the Vietnam Service Medal, Vietnam Combat Medal , Expert Rifle Marksman, and the Combat Infantry Badge. Leroy retired from the Army on September 13, 1971. Leroy worked at Safeway for 30 years and was the co-owner of the Pack Rat in Raton , New Mexico.
He was deeply loved by his family and friends. He was a dedicated husband, father and grandfather. Leroy loved being a wood worker, and a contributor to his community, He also enjoyed pulling his hair out watching his Broncos. Leroy never met anybody he didn’t know!
